Default Do Depository Charges Apply to Intraday Trade?



Well today by mistake instead of putting a sell order of one share I placed a buy order.

The shares got bought at 98.95 per share. 35 shares bought.

With brokerage charge went to around 99.8.

To cover up my mistake. I calculated that if I sell all shares today at 101.75 I will be back to square zero.

Fortunately shares got sold. But bad luck 10 remained.

Now my contract note shows 10 shares at 97.71.

I was little happy then I realized there was a sell. So next month there might be Rs 28 something as depository charges.

But I am not sure since contract note shows an entry of 35 shares buy and 25 share sold. So sum total 10 shares buy.

I wanted to know does depository charges apply for non delivery shares too?

No, DP charges are applicable only when shares are debited from your demat account.

The amount for the 25 shares should be adjusted by broker as intra day settlement without delivery.

It depends on the broker.

In case of Kotak Securities/Kotak Bank, DP charges are applicable for shares sold on T+1 day.

Quote:
10. How would the movement of shares transacted for BNST-G/BNST reflect in the Demat account?

A. The shares that have been bought and subsequently sold under BNST-G/BNST would be first credited and then debited from your DEMAT ACCOUNT as per normal pay in and pay out. You would not be required to do anything different from your normal transaction.
